Prenatal Cocaine Exposures addresses the timely problem of maternal
cocaine abuse and its effects on exposed infants, including growth
retardation, learning, cardiovascular effects, and seizures. The
impact of substance abuse on this and future generations presents
an ongoing challenge to medical science. This comprehensive and
authoritative volume reviews both animal and clinical studies to
explain implications for treatment and long-term outcomes of early
exposure.
Prenatal Cocaine Exposures investigates the specific role of
cocaine in altering fetal development. Discussions of current
studies and state-of-the-art techniques provide a basis for
informed clinical decisions. Pediatricians, medical specialists,
basic scientists, educators, and policy makers will all benefit
from the comprehensive research gathered in this volume.
